Table AV11: Imports from Canada with Port Geography and State of Destination Detail
Excel
|
CSV
Field Name
Data Element
Description
Type
Width
DISAGMOT
Disaggregated MOT
Method of transportation by which the commodities are exported; "1" = air, "3" = vessel
Character
1
DESTATE
U.S. State
U.S. state of destination.
Character
2
DEPE
District and Port of Entry or Export
Four-digit classification of U.S. Customs districts and ports
Character
2
COUNTRY
Country of Origin or Destination
"2010" to denote Mexico or "1220" to denote Canada
Character
4
VALUE
Value of Shipments
Commodity value in U.S. $
Numeric
11
CHARGES
Aggregate Charges
Aggregate shipping charges on imports, in U.S. $
Numeric
11
SHIPWT
Shipping Weight
Commodity weight in kilograms
Numeric
11
STATMOYR
Statistical Month and Year
MMYY. Example 0592 = May 1992.
Character
4
